The Puppy's Choice
Puppies are a big commitment, and it is essential that everyone in the family buys into this. It is also crucial that your lifestyle and home environment are suitable for dogs. If you are not able to commit the time, energy, and security that dogs require, then you should not get one. A poor decision taken now could cause problems for a long time.
Responsible breeders put the health and well-being of their puppies first. They will help you select the best puppy for your personality. They will also help you find a responsible way to take the puppy home and care for it during its early years.
Don't buy a dog from a place which is not a registered breeder or seller. These places are known as Puppy Farms. These places abuse puppies and frequently use cages that are too small for the dogs to lie down comfortably. These puppies are taken away from their mothers too soon and can cause behavioral issues later on in the course of their lives. They are also fed low quality food and given insufficient veterinary attention.
When selecting a puppy from a breeder be sure to meet the mother and siblings. This is a good opportunity to observe the parents for any behavioral characteristics that could be passed to the puppies. Also look at the genitalia of male puppies to ensure they have two testicles - If they only have one, it's a sign of cryptorchidism that requires further surgical intervention to correct the issue.
It is not a good idea to pick the puppy who is rushing towards you. This is usually the one who is bully. It is also not advisable to pick the timid or scared puppy just because you feel regretful about it. These puppies might be easier to train however they are less likely to possess the personality you desire in your pet. A puppy is a significant commitment, so you should ensure that the puppy is the right one for you and your family.
Finding a Puppy Home
Getting a puppy is a wonderful time for a family. Puppies are bundles of cuteness that will melt the heart of anyone. They also have a plethora of energy and can be a bit of a handful. Doing your research ahead of time is vital to ensure that you are prepared for the arrival of a puppy. This includes researching vets in your area and preparing your home by puppy-proofing it. It is important to have water, food, beds, toys and Axel terrier Welpen kaufen other items on hand.
It is recommended to visit a breeder and see the surroundings before deciding on which puppy to purchase. A responsible breeder will accept your visit and be capable of answering any questions. If a breeder is unwilling to let you visit their facility or insists that the puppies are too young to leave their mother, that is a red signal and you should walk away.
You should be able observe the puppies in their mother's care and be able to see how they interact with each other and the human members of the household. Be aware of the behavior of the puppies and be cautious of any that hide away or seem fearful when approached. These are indicators of possible health issues.
A responsible breeder must have a health certification for each puppy they sell, and be able to provide you with the results of genetic tests performed on the father and mother. Avoid breeders who do not require these documents because they often put the puppy at risk for serious health issues in the near future.

Taking Care of a Puppy
Puppies can be cute and cuddly but they are also a lot of hard work. From the moment of their birth, they require constant care and attention. They need to be fed regularly and walked frequently to help them burn off energy, and then rewarded for their good behavior. If you're not ready to make this commitment it is recommended to avoid acquiring an animal.
Newborn puppies are fragile and aren't able to regulate their body temperature until they reach three weeks old. If you decide to purchase puppies that are younger than this, make sure it's kept warm and has plenty of room to move around within. You'll be able to see that the heart rate of newborn puppies is high. This is normal.
The first thing you need to do to take care of your puppy is remove any potentially hazardous items from its surroundings. This includes removing items that could be eaten, such as wires and electrical cords. You should then take your puppy to the vet or pet store for vaccinations and health checkups. A veterinarian can give you advice about the food and vaccines that are appropriate for your puppy.
After your puppy has been vaccine-vaccinated and current on their health checks, it's important to introduce them to a variety of experiences to aid in developing social skills. This will allow them to become a more rounded adult dog that is more comfortable in various environments and situations. This means taking your dog to the car, grooming him, and having his ears, eyes and other body parts checked. You can also begin to leave them alone for short intervals of time to avoid anxiety about separation when you're not home.
It's also a good idea to get your puppy comfortable with nail trims and brushing their coat and teeth so that they don't get scared of these tasks when they become an adult dog. You should also make sure that your puppy sleeps in a place away from noise and heat and has access water.

Potty training is easier when your puppy has a regular schedule. For instance having a pre-determined bedtime will help your pet settle into a routine of sleep that supports their physical and emotional health. It can also be helpful to help your puppy feel secure and at ease in a crate -- a great tool for house training since it can prevent the dog from excreting in a way that isn't appropriate when they're asleep.
The first few weeks and months of your puppy's development lay the foundations for their physical and mental health, behavior, and personality. The idea of taking your puppy out to experience a variety of smells, sounds, places and people is crucial to help them become confident and at ease in the world around them. Make sure you get your vet's approval prior to the introduction of your puppy to other animals or people.
It is a good idea to begin obedience training early, as it will reinforce positive behaviors and reduce undesirable ones. Ideally your puppy will be taught with a reward-based system that rewards good behavior with small food items or toys. This approach helps to build trust and establish an enduring relationship that will last a life time.
